Meaning of Pommie-basher | Babel Free

Noun CEFR C1
ˈpɒmibaʃə

Definitions

Someone who habitually criticizes England or English people.

slang

Examples

“The ceremony was dignified and touching…The sing-along was most enjoyable even though some of the words were a little different to the ones I knew and even the most ardent ‘Pommie Basher’ surely would not have disapproved of our rendition of Waltzing Matilda.'--Lt Col (Retd) Mick Berrill, OBE”
